Using neural networks for calibration of time- domain reflectometry measurements
Time-domain reflectometry (TDR) is an electromagnetic technique for measurements of water and solute transport in soils. The relationship between the TDR-measured dielectric constant (Ka) and bulk soil electrical conductivity (cra) to water content (8W) and solute concentration is difficult to describe physically due to the complex dielectric response of wet soil. متن کاملInvestigation of the Effect Soil particles size on the Currency Time Domain Reflectometry for water content measurement
This study carried out on the provided textures at laboratory. The provided textures were infusedinside the PVC cylinder with 30cm height and 25cm diameter. The studied textures were loamysand, sandy loam, sandy clay-loam, clay loam and clay.
